Miami Beach’s First Medical Marijuana Dispensary Opens

In this video, viewers will learn about a significant shift in marijuana policy as Senate Minority Leader Chuck Schumer announces plans to decriminalize marijuana at the federal level. At the same time, Miami Beach celebrates the grand opening of its first medical marijuana dispensary, signaling growing support and demand. Criminal defense attorney Albert Quirantes shares his legal insight, while politicians and advocates weigh in on the future of marijuana in Florida. The video also explores how public opinion is shifting by age group and what the potential legal, social, and economic implications could be.

Florida’s GOP Goes Green: Will Weed Be Legalized? Possible Changes Coming to Marijuana Laws

In Florida, some Republican lawmakers are advocating for expanded access to both medical and recreational marijuana.
Following nearly 56% voter approval for recreational use in the last election, two new proposals aim to allow home cultivation for medical marijuana patients and fully legalize recreational use for adults 21 and older.
The proposed House bill would permit adults to purchase up to two ounces of flower and five grams of concentrate while also restructuring the medical marijuana industry to allow more competition. Although these measures are sponsored by GOP lawmakers, it’s uncertain how much support they’ll receive in the legislature.
Meanwhile, efforts are already underway to place recreational marijuana on the ballot for the 2026 election.

Marijuana Adult Personal Use: Florida legalization on the ballot as Amendment 3

Allows adults 21 years or older to possess, purchase, or use marijuana products and marijuana accessories for non-medical personal consumption by smoking, ingestion, or otherwise; allows Medical Marijuana Treatment Centers, and other state licensed entities, to acquire, cultivate, process, manufacture, sell, and distribute such products and accessories. Applies to Florida law; does not change, or immunize violations of, federal law. Establishes possession limits for personal use. Allows consistent legislation. Defines terms. Provides effective date.

Legalization of marijuana on the ballot for Florida voters | The Hill

Florida Amendment 3, the Marijuana Legalization Initiative, is on the state’s ballots in the upcoming general election. If 60% of state voters approve the amendment, Florida will join 24 other states and the District of Columbia where recreational cannabis is legal. Trump backs marijuana legalization in Florida if ‘done correctly’

Former President Donald Trump said he expected a ballot measure in Florida to legalize marijuana to pass in a new TruthSocial post, but called on the state legislature to create laws to prevent the use of the drug in public.

Trump framed his position as one consistent with his “Make America Safe Again” agenda, writing that criminalizing marijuana would “waste Taxpayer Dollars arresting adults with personal amounts of it on them.”

Florida surpasses 700K medical marijuana patients

There are now 700,000 medical marijuana patients in the state of Florida. That’s more than twice as many as there were at the beginning of the pandemic.

While pot proponents might cheer that statistic, critics say it’s starting to remind them of the old pill mill days in Florida with too many doctors writing too many prescriptions.
